re PR target/86014 ([AArch64] missed LDP optimization)
authorJackson Woodruff <jackson.woodruff@arm.com>
Thu, 2 Aug 2018 10:39:23 +0000 (10:39 +0000)
committerJackson Woodruff <jcw@gcc.gnu.org>
Thu, 2 Aug 2018 10:39:23 +0000 (10:39 +0000)
commit363b395bad6e45bb5d6e4924ff4f49400653f011
treedc6012ac1091127243d86548e32f1e4abee0854f
parentca498a11887e4d6b6a635db3e7df8b93804a4478
re PR target/86014 ([AArch64] missed LDP optimization)

gcc/
2018-08-02  Jackson Woodruff  <jackson.woodruff@arm.com>

PR target/86014
* config/aarch64/aarch64.c (aarch64_operands_adjust_ok_for_ldpstp):
No longer check last store for clobber of address register.

gcc/testsuite
2018-08-02  Jackson Woodruff  <jackson.woodruff@arm.com>

PR target/86014
* gcc.target/aarch64/ldp_stp_13.c: New test.

From-SVN: r263249
gcc/ChangeLog
gcc/config/aarch64/aarch64.c
gcc/testsuite/ChangeLog
gcc/testsuite/gcc.target/aarch64/ldp_stp_13.c [new file with mode: 0644]